Experience: 8+ years in ML/AI (incl. DL/RL in production)
Education: Master's (preferred) or Bachelor's in CS, Data Science, or Mathematics
About the Role
Own the full lifecycle of enterprise-scale AI solutions — architecture through production — and set technical best practices, governance, and standards across the team. A player-coach leadership role.
Key Responsibilities
- Architect end-to-end DL/RL and agentic AI solutions from design to production.
- Set technical standards, governance, and evaluation frameworks across the team.
- Optimize models for production inference (TensorRT/ONNX/Triton); balance accuracy vs. latency.
- Scale training/inference on Azure ML, AKS/ARO, and distributed infrastructure.
- Lead technical solutioning, manage stakeholders, and mentor engineers.
Must-Have Skills
- 7+ years ML/AI with production DL and/or RL systems.
- Mastery of DL frameworks (PyTorch/TensorFlow/JAX) and robust applied math (linear algebra, probability, optimization).
- Deep learning across CNNs, transformers, and sequence models; RL agents (PPO, SAC, TD3, CQL).
- Inference optimization (TensorRT/ONNX/Triton) and accuracy vs. latency benchmarking.
- Model serving and containerized deployment at scale (Docker/Kubernetes, AKS/ARO).
- Cloud-scale training/inference on Azure ML with distributed training and MLOps/CI-CD.
- Ability to define standards, governance, and evaluation frameworks across a team.
- Proven technical leadership, mentoring, and stakeholder communication.
- Track record of 6–10 production deployments with measurable business impact.
